Description
OD-TRISS series outdoor hybrid telecom power system (represented by model OD-TRISS-48100) is an all-in-one multi-energy integrated outdoor power cabinet launched by CONSNANT, integrating rectifier modules, inverter modules, high-voltage MPPT solar charge modules, intelligent thermal management, power distribution circuit and power & environment monitoring system as a single unit.
Different from single-function outdoor power supplies, the TRISS triple-module architecture combines AC rectification, PV power generation and AC inversion, supporting three energy sources: municipal AC grid, photovoltaic solar and battery energy storage (LiFePO4 or VRLA lead-acid battery). It provides stable -48VDC telecom power and 220/230VAC auxiliary alternating current output, creating a fully safe, sealed and temperature-controlled operating environment for outdoor communication equipment, widely deployed on off-grid, weak-grid and coastal/mountain remote communication base stationsConsnant.
The cabinet adopts standard RAL7035 industrial gray metal enclosure, standard IP55 outdoor protection grade, with complete dustproof, waterproof and anti-salt spray performance. It supports floor-standing installation, customizable internal equipment space, and multiple optional cooling & heating configurations to match various regional climate conditions.

Core Product Advantages
1. Triple Modular Hybrid Architecture, Flexible Capacity Expansion
Equipped with interchangeable hot-pluggable rectifier, inverter and MPPT modules, each module quantity configurable from 1~4 units for capacity expansion:
• Rectifier module: 3000W standard / 4000W optional, max system DC power up to 16kW, max DC output current 400A
• Inverter module: 2000VA per unit, max AC output power 8kW
• MPPT solar module: 3000W per unit, high-efficiency photovoltaic energy harvesting
All modules share unified size specification (≤2kg per module), light weight for easy maintenance, redundant parallel design with current sharing imbalance ≤±5% within 50%~100% load range, high system reliability.
2. Ultra-Wide Input Adaptability, Stable Output Performance
• AC input: 85~300Vac single/three-phase, 45~65Hz wide frequency, power factor ≥0.97 under rated load, adaptable to unstable rural remote power grids
• PV input: 120~425VDC wide MPPT range, max PV voltage 450Vdc, built-in reverse polarity protection and PV fuse protection, no damage under wrong wiring
• DC output fixed telecom standard: -43.2~-57.6Vdc (typical float voltage -53.5Vdc), voltage stabilization accuracy ≤±1%, output ripple ≤200mVp-p, rectifier efficiency optional 93%/95%/96%, MPPT efficiency ≥96%, inverter efficiency ≥90%
3. Full-Range Environmental Adaptability & Diversified Thermal Solutions
• Operating temperature: -20℃ ~ +45℃; storage temperature: -40℃ ~ +70℃; applicable altitude ≤4000m (derate output for 3000~4000m highland)
• Humidity tolerance: 5%~90%RH non-condensing
• Multiple cooling options: 48V PWM temperature-adjustable single/dual fan (100W); 500W/1000W/1500W AC/DC air conditioner; 500W/1000W heat exchanger; optional 500W heating module for cold northern areas
• Two cabinet dimensions for choice: without air conditioner (759×693×1430mm, 150kg); with air conditioner (759×817×1430mm, 180kg)
4. Comprehensive Multi-Level Safety Protection
• PV side: reverse connection protection, positive/negative fuse overcurrent protection
• AC & DC side: overvoltage, undervoltage, overcurrent, short-circuit, overheat protection
• Parallel module current sharing balance control to avoid single module overload
• Complete lightning surge protection matched with outdoor cabinet
• Dry contact alarm signal output for remote fault notification
5. Built-In Intelligent Power & Environment Monitoring System
Integrated monitoring unit with independent module spare slots, collecting real-time data of AC input, PV power, DC output, battery voltage/current, cabinet internal temperature, fan/air conditioner operating status. Reserved dry contact monitoring signal interfaces, supporting unattended remote site management, real-time fault alarm and parameter remote configuration.
